Coin Pass Through

A Coin Trick

This is an easy to learn and implement trick...
with little practice you can master it with ease.

Materials Needed:

  • 2 identical coins
  • a small piece of transparent adhesive tape or magicians wax

The Trick:

You ask the spectator to hold out his or her hand palm up. You in turn place your hand on top of theirs, palm down. With your other hand you place a quarter or other coin on top of your hand and explain to the spectator that with one quick slap of the coin you will make it pass through your hand and into theirs!


When you place your hand on top of the spectators open hand, you will already have the coin in your palm. If you place your hand on theirs quickly enough , the coin will not fall nor will the spectator already feel it in their hand ! You then place the "other" coin on top, on the back of your hand.

On the palm of your hand which is not touching the spectators, is where the tape or wax will be. Then with a quick motion, you smack the top of the coin,which actually gets stuck to the tape/wax. Slowly remove your other hand to let the surprised spectator see how it "magically" passed through your hand!

Notes: Practice this trick before performing. It's easy to get confused on how a coin trick works just from reading about it.
